Daniel Reid Obermire
1970 - 2007

Daniel Reid Obermire, 36, of Oskaloosa, died Thursday, Oct. 4, 2007, of injuries received in an automobile accident.

He was born Dec. 7, 1970, at Fort Belvoir, Va., the son of Joseph and Marilyn Binns Obermire. He graduated from the Oskaloosa High School with the class of 1989. During college Dan moved to Newark, N.J., and worked as a nanny. He returned to Oskaloosa and finished his Bachelor's Degree in Elementary Education in 1994. He later earned his Master's in Educational Administration from Northwest Missouri State in 2003.

Following school he worked as a substitute teacher in the Oskaloosa Community Schools, and worked as a t-ball coach and the swim team coach at the YMCA. On Nov. 29, 1997, he was united in marriage to Tonya Ewen at the Central United Methodist Church in Oskaloosa. Dan's first full time teaching position was at Clarke of Osceola where he taught 5th grade and coached junior high volleyball and baseball from 1996 - 2000. In 2000 he moved back to Oskaloosa to teach 6th grade, first at Webster Elementary, and was currently teaching Language Arts at the Oskaloosa Middle School. In 2002 Dan was recognized by Wal-Mart as Oskaloosa's Teacher of the Year. Dan was a member of the Central United Methodist where he was active in youth ministry, Webb Lodge #182 of the Masons in Sigourney, National Wild Turkey Federation, Oskaloosa Education Association, and he was currently serving on the Oskaloosa Public Library Board.

He enjoyed spending time in the out of doors, was an avid hunter, and enjoyed fishing (especially for trout). He was a true Nebraska Cornhusker fan. He especially delighted in spending time with his family.

His family includes his wife, Tonya Obermire of Oskaloosa, two children: Elise(8) and Ethan(5) Obermire both at home in Oskaloosa; his parents: Joseph and Marilyn Obermire of Oskaloosa; a brother: Michael (Ang) Obermire of Lavista, Neb.; a sister: Susan (Nathan) Rosengren of Missouri Valley; his parents-in-law: Don and Carolyn Ewen of Rockford; a sister- in-law: Jessie (Jason) Reicks of Rockford,; a brother-in-law: Cole Ewen of Troy, Mo.; his grandparents-in-law: Boyd and Louise Burnett of Rudd; and several aunts, uncles, cousins, nieces and nephews.

He was preceded in death by his maternal grandparents: Bennie and Mabel Binns, and his paternal grandparents: Gus and Viola Obermire.

Funeral services were held Tuesday, Oct. 9, 2007, at 6 p.m. in the Central United Methodist Church in Oskaloosa with Reverends Robert Dean and Robert Morris Officiating. According to Dan's wishes his body has been cremated. In lieu of flowers the family would like memorials to be made out to the Central United Methodist Church or the Oskaloosa Middle School.
